Overview
Profile an API endpoint to identify performance bottlenecks and optimization opportunities.
Steps
- Identify the target endpoint (URL, method, and payload).
- Analyze the handler code path:
- Map all database queries executed per request.
- Identify external API calls and their expected latency.
- Check for synchronous blocking operations.
- Look for N+1 query patterns.
- Measure baseline performance:
- Send sample requests and measure response time.
- Check memory allocation during request handling.
- Identify the slowest operations in the call chain.
- Check for common performance issues:
- Missing database indexes for frequently queried columns.
- Unbounded result sets without pagination.
- Redundant data fetching (loading full objects when only IDs needed).
- Missing caching for expensive computations.
- Large response payloads without compression.
- Suggest optimizations ranked by expected impact:
- Add database indexes.
- Implement caching layer.
- Batch database queries.
- Add pagination.
- Enable response compression.
- Estimate performance improvement for each suggestion.

Rules
- Profile with realistic data volumes, not empty databases.
- Measure P50, P95, and P99 latencies, not just averages.
- Identify the single biggest bottleneck before suggesting broad optimizations.
- Never suggest premature optimization for endpoints under 100ms.
- Consider read vs write path optimizations separately.
